Variablen werden in includierter Datei nicht verwendet - warum - Lösung?

dwex

Erfahrenes Mitglied
Hallo Leute,

ich habe ein PHP-Script welches in etwas so aussieht:
PHP:
<?php
if($zeilen == 1) {
     $kdnr = "12345";
     include "kundenverwaltung.php";
     exit;
}
Also er soll mir wenn er nur eine Zeile gefunden hat die Seite "kundenverwaltung.php" includieren - das Funktioniert auch - aber die Variable $kdnr wird in der includierten Datei nicht verwendet.
Warum ist das so und wie kann ich das ggf. ändern?

ich habe auch schon
PHP:
include "kundenverwaltung.php?kdnr=12345";
probiert aber da bekomme ich die (eigentlich logische) Meldung das die Datei nicht existiert.
 
Hallo,

hier der Teil aus der "kundenverwaltung.php"
Ich bin selber drauf gekommen - es liegt an der Get-Geschichte (Tomaten von den Augen nehm)

PHP:
if($_GET['kdnr'] != "") {

$sql = "SELECT * FROM `kunden` WHERE kdnr = '$_GET[kdnr]'ORDER BY `kdnr` ASC Limit 0,1";
$abfrage = mysql_query($sql);

$ds = mysql_fetch_assoc($abfrage);

$zeilen = mysql_num_rows($abfrage);

if($zeilen == 0) { $zeilenfehler = 1; }


}
Danke für den Tip mit der kundenverwaltung.php
 
Zurück